### **Subarachnoid Space**
27
28
- The **subarachnoid space** is located between the arachnoid and pia mater. This space is filled with cerebrospinal fluid (CSF)
which helps cushion the brain and spinal cord.

### **Peripheral Nerves**
31
32
- Once the nerves exit the protective skull and vertebrae
they are called **peripheral nerves** and have additional layers of connective tissue for protection.
